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) - Barsar, Hamirpur
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) is a village situated in the Barsar tehsil of Hamirpur district, Himachal Pradesh. Kyarabagh serves as the Gram Panchayat for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) is 017484. The village covers a total geographical area of 23.04 hectares and falls under the 174311 pincode. Bhota is the nearest town.
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Pradhan ser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Barsar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Hamirpur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Sunwin Brahmna (33/11)
According to the 2011 Census,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) village had a total population of 85 people, including 33 males and 52 females, living in 18 households. The sex ratio was 1,576 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 81.94%, with male literacy at 92.00% and female literacy at 76.60%.

Transport and Connectivity of Sunwin Brahmna (33/11)
Sunwin Brahmna (33/11) is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ared van services.
